Description
A simple and delicious easy enchilada bake recipe perfect for beginners.
Ingredients

- 12 corn tortillas
- 2 cups shredded chicken
- 1 can black beans, drained and rinsed
- 2 cups enchilada sauce
- 2 cups shredded cheese
- 1 cup diced onions
- 1 teaspoon cumin
- 1 teaspoon garlic powder
- Salt and pepper to taste
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C).
- In a large bowl, combine shredded chicken, black beans, onions, cumin, garlic powder, salt, and pepper.
- Spread a layer of enchilada sauce on the bottom of a baking dish.
- Place 4 tortillas on top of the sauce, overlapping them slightly.
- Add half of the chicken mixture on top of the tortillas.
- Sprinkle with 1 cup of cheese.
- Repeat the layers with another 4 tortillas, remaining chicken mixture, and another cup of cheese.
- Add the final layer of 4 tortillas on top and cover with remaining enchilada sauce and cheese.
- Cover the dish with aluminum foil and bake for 20 minutes.
- Remove the foil and bake for an additional 10-15 minutes until the cheese is bubbly and golden.
- Let it cool for a few minutes before serving.
Notes
- Use pre-cooked chicken to save time.
- Feel free to add vegetables like bell peppers or corn.
- Adjust the spice level by using mild or hot enchilada sauce.
